Advertisement
Guest User

Untitled

a guest
Feb 23rd, 2017
123
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 0.43 KB | None | 0 0
  1. void Menu::addMenuItem(std::string labelIn)
  2. {
  3.     if (top->label == "") {
  4.         top->label = labelIn;
  5.         top->next = top;
  6.         top->previous = top;
  7.     }
  8.     else {
  9.         MenuItem *newItem = new MenuItem;
  10.  
  11.         newItem->next = top;
  12.         newItem->previous = top->previous;
  13.         top->previous->next = newItem;
  14.         top->previous = newItem;
  15.         newItem->label = labelIn;
  16.         top = newItem;
  17.     }
  18.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ement